(Limited Editions Club of New York.) Classical Greek Authors: Homer. The Odyssey. 1931. #558/1500. 4to, orig. cloth; slightly scuffed, minor dust soiling, spine faded, moderate wear & some dust soiling to slipcase. * Longus. The Pastoral Loves of Daphnis and Chloe. 1934. Illus. by Ruth Reeves. #906/1500 signed by Reeves. 4to, orig. lambskin; scuffed, edge wear & some dust soiling to slipcase. * Epicurus. [Works.] 1947. #974/1500. 8vo, orig. morocco; spine occasionally slightly chipped, light wear to slipcase. * Appollonius Rhodius. Argonautica. 1957. Designed by A. Tassos. #29/1500 signed by Tassos. Folio, orig. cloth; light to moderate wear, front hinge stressed, edges of slipcase rather worn. * Herodotus. The Histories. Illus. by Edward Bawden. #451/1500 signed by Bawden. 8vo, orig. cloth; light wear, top of slipcase slightly darkened. * Homer. The Odyssey. (1960). Illus. by Barry Moser. #1547/2000 signed by Moser. 4to, orig. cloth; minor wear, some dampstaining to slipcase. * Plato. The Trial and Death of Socrates. 1962. Illus. by Hans Erni. #649/1500 signed by Erni. 4to, orig. cloth, d/j; some fading to edges of slipcase. * _ _. Lysis,... The Symposium, Phaedrus. 1968. Illus. by Eugene Karlin. #740/1500 signed by Karlin. 4to, orig. goatskin vellum & bds., glassine, slipcase occasionally slightly dusty. * Xenophon. The Anabasis. 1969. Illus. by A. Tassos. #1023/1500 signed by Tassos. 4to, orig. cloth, glassine. * Thucydides. The Peloponnesian War. 1974. Illus. by A. Tassos. #246/2000 signed by Tassos. 2 vols. 4to, orig. cloth, glassine. All in slipcases. Glassine, when present, usually chipped.
